I hate these kinds of picks tbh. There’s a premium on skill position players and if you want one that’s going to upgrade your offense you really have to go early, you’re almost always otherwise just adding a JAG, which this offense didn’t need any more of. We were fine at depth at WR. He was part of a record setting run of WRs drafted and I just overall prefer playing the board in the 3rd round at positions that don’t start to come off until later.

theres stuff to like though. He bends and moves a lot better than the other Tennessee wide receivers did and do, hands catcher. He could be very good. 

i just hate the ethos of thinking you can “wait until later” to get a perimeter player and then expecting them to come in and be someone they almost always aren’t. Could we have gotten a plug and play safety in the third round? You usually can.
